Mariah Carey’s timeless holiday hit, “All I Want for Christmas Is You,” is not just the soundtrack of Christmas—it’s an unstoppable money-making machine. With each passing year, the song continues to bring in millions, making Carey’s Christmas royalties feel like an infinite money glitch that leaves everyone else in the dust.

Every December, Carey’s classic earns her a jaw-dropping $3 million annually from royalties alone. And that’s just the tip of the iceberg. With streaming revenues surpassing $60 million and additional profits pouring in from album sales, downloads, and licensing, Carey’s Christmas cash flow is truly the gift that keeps on giving.

“All I Want for Christmas Is You” has spent 14 weeks at the top of the Billboard Hot 100, and its record-shattering success continues. In 2023, the song broke streaming records with a mind-blowing 23.7 million streams on Christmas Day alone, bringing the total closer to 2 billion streams.
